Snortimer wrote: Tue Mar 26, 2019 1:38 Are there any pixel art-specific tools that make this sort of shading quicker to experiment with these days?
There's mtPaint, which was developed with pixel art in mind, and has the ability to paint full dithered patterns with a single brush stroke.
